Transaction 28f792d37ba33a08f01cf2aa43a415e3a350594ca4fe3dd45146eb41fb34bcbd
3 Input
2 Outputs
- 28f792d37ba33a08f01cf2aa43a415e3a350594ca4fe3dd45146eb41fb34bcbd:0
- 28f792d37ba33a08f01cf2aa43a415e3a350594ca4fe3dd45146eb41fb34bcbd:1
value 34592
address 1EFWTPfEfhi9Q7Tk7JzdSQBzXh2jkQhBu3
value 1985673
address 3P3VGZ5RnNNL11eUrTL5SQFcW3mkpcewcy